Abstract
An apparatus for forming ultrafine particles, including: a light source generating a laser beam to be irradiated at an organic substance; at least one microflow channel capable of passing therethrough a suspension containing the organic substance; and a flow device for allowing the suspension containing the organic substance to continuously or intermittently pass through the microflow channel, the organic substance present in the microflow channel being irradiated with the laser beam at least once within a predetermined period, thereby forming ultrafine particles of the organic substance.
